Index Living Mall unveils new store concept in Bangkok

Index Living Mall has unveiled its next retail concept in Bangkok’s Ekkamai district, with a focus on apartment furnishings, fresh graphics and new store layout.

Called ‘ Fresh-up Ekkamai, lift-up your life’, the concept introduces new zones and features a variety of new-to-market homewares and furniture items.

The “Condo Collection” zone presents furniture specially designed for condominiums, while the “Younique” zone offers customized furniture. Other zones include a Sofa & Recliner Exhibition, Outdoor life and Storage Solutions & Home Organisation.

Index Living Mall MD, Kridchanok Patamasatayasonthi, said the store’s renovation was undertaken because Ekkamai is becoming a popular residential neighborhood, with multiple condominium units rented to both locals and foreigners.

The new concept store will suit shoppers with tight budgets who are seeking functional items for compact living spaces.

Index Living Mall’s Ekkamai store also offers customers free consultations with in-house specialists.
